Mission Statement
To partner with our community in creating a no-kill Pima County. To find loving homes for every treatable and adoptable animal in our care. To collaborate with other local animal welfare agencies to broaden the safety net for homeless animals in our community.
Description
Pima Paws For Life (PPFL), is a 501c3 private adoption guarantee (no kill) animal shelter in Tucson, AZ. PPFL takes in sick and injured animals, with a focus on pulling from Pima Animal Care Center along with PACC shelter diversions and a few rural shelters, to help reduce the euthanasia rate of dogs and cats with treatable conditions. PPFL treats animals with upper respiratory infections (URI's) also known as kennel cough, valley fever, pneumonia, distemper, parvo, injuries, and behavioral issues as well as many other problems. Once healthy and cleared by the vet, the animals then become available for adoption.
